Beauty Spot Back Again.

It is said that the women in Paris are again wearing the beauty spot. Next to ha\ing a small black mole placed near a fpscinating dimple, a little piece of black court piaster calls attention loudly to the chaims near it. A beauty spot is nothing move than a ''barker lor the attraction^ oi eyes or month or dimple whkh n.iajhl. possibly pass unnoticed a these little dots weie not Iheie to advertise them. Like postage starmis, beauty spots have a language to themsehes. The spot nearest the eye tells of the danger that lurko v.ithin the beautiful glance of. tlie wearer, and is called "killing.' 1 The mischief-maker lies in the crease at the corner of a smiling mouth: while the woman who flatters herself on her superior intelligence can place a laige spot upon her brow, signifying that treasures are bulled behind it. Coquetry, the question— all these spots' haie theii special places upon the map of the face, and when a black dot is placed noon the right cheek its significance is uiteily difierent trom that ot the same spot upon the left cheek. Though it's just as veil to know the language oi these dots, when wearing them it is as v. ell not to be guided by it, but to place the soot on that part of the face where it will met accentuate the wearer's natural charms. If you ha\e good eyes, for instance, but don't' caic toi yuur mouth. pit the beauty t.pot near the "eyes. If you have an oval face and peihups a dimpled chin, place the beaxitv spot low on the face, to call attention to your superiority iv the matter of chins. The girl with a tiny, straight nose can aiford to put her spot near her nose, but your average nondescript noc-e should not" he called retention to with such a '-display adv2iti=ement."
